Phoenix Adept
Powers :
1) Biotic Guard : Amplifies biotic skills. Deals more biotic damage, higher recharge rate for all powers, faster shield recharge and health regeneration. Detonate Biotic Guard to instantly recharge shields. Slows movement and gun reload speed by 50%. Base recharge : 12 seconds.
Rank 1 : 10% more biotic damage, 15% faster recharge for all powers, detonate to recharge 50% of shields
Rank 2 : 25% recharge speed.
Rank 3 : 15% faster shield recharge, 20 points health regeneration per 5 seconds.
Rank 4 : +15% faster shield recharge, +30 points health regeneration per 5 seconds
or +20% more biotic damage, +15% faster recharge for all powers
Rank 5 : 30% recharge speed
or +50% shields recharged upon detonation, reduced movement and reload penalty by 30%
Rank 6 : 100% health regeneration upon detonation
or +30% more biotic damage, 30% faster recharge for all powers
2) Warp
3) Channel : Absorbs health of unshielded enemies to regenerate nearby allies health. Deals damage to shielded targets instead. Base recharge speed : 8 seconds
Rank 1 : Damage : 300, recovers 25% health of all nearby allies (up to 5m). 100% damage to shielded or armor targets.
Rank 2 : 20% faster recharge
Rank 3 : +25% damage increase
Rank 4 : +25% damage increase
or recovers 50% health of all nearby allies (up to 5m)
Rank 5 : +30% damage increase
or increase range of regeneration by 50% (up to 7.5m) and +20% faster recharge
Rank 6 : +30% damage increase
or the ability to absorbs health and shields of armored targets
4) Assassin Training : More weapon damage, Weapons weight reduction, Increased movement speed and reload speed of weapons.
5) The Phoenix : More health and shields, Increased biotic damage and recharge speed.
So, pretty much with this class, it's all about versatility. You can either play support (Biotic guard for max health and shields regeneration, Channel for max health recovery of nearby allies, Assassin training focusing on weight reduction, and The Phoenix on increase biotic damage and recharge speed) or aggro (Biotic Guard for max power damage and recharge, warp for max damage and detonation, Channel for max damage) or even a phew-phew shooter (Biotic Guard spec for reduced movement and speed penalty with health and shield regeneration, Assassin Training for more weapon damage and increase reload speed and The Phoenix for more health and shields).
